OVERALL: R1
Deluxe Edition has two additional featurettes.
If you want the box set, choose "Classic Christmas Favorites" or "Santa's Magical Stories". They include additional short films. -
CUTS:
- R1 America- Warner Home Video - No cuts.
- R1 Deluxe Edition America- Warner Home Video - No cuts (50:45 NTSC).
